Silky smooth soy pudding with sweet ginger syrup. tau foo fah or douhua (in mandarin) is a chinese dessert made with very soft tofu eaten with a clear sweet syrup infused with ginger or pandan. Soaking, blending the beans (not too difficult) and squeezing out the liquid (quite tricky). the traditional or commercial way of making tofu pudding is through the use of gypsum powder, which you can find at a good asian grocery.
